Understanding the Composition of Natural Face Creams
Natural face creams distinguish themselves from their conventional counterparts through their reliance on plant-derived ingredients and avoidance of synthetic chemicals. Key components often include botanical oils, such as jojoba oil, rosehip oil, argan oil, and avocado oil, each possessing unique properties beneficial to the skin. These oils act as emollients, softening and moisturizing the skin, while also providing antioxidants to combat free radical damage. Butters, like shea butter and cocoa butter, contribute richness and intense hydration, creating a protective barrier against environmental stressors. Herbal extracts, such as chamomile, aloe vera, and calendula, are frequently incorporated for their soothing, anti-inflammatory, and healing properties.
Key Ingredients and Their Benefits
- Jojoba Oil: Mimics the skin's natural sebum, regulating oil production and promoting a balanced complexion.
- Rosehip Oil: Rich in vitamins A and C, promoting collagen production and reducing the appearance of wrinkles and scars.
- Argan Oil: A potent antioxidant, protecting against environmental damage and improving skin elasticity.
- Avocado Oil: Hydrates deeply, providing relief for dry and irritated skin.
- Shea Butter: A powerful emollient, intensely moisturizing and protecting the skin's barrier function.
- Cocoa Butter: Similar to shea butter, providing deep hydration and a smooth, supple texture.
- Chamomile Extract: Soothes inflammation and irritation, particularly beneficial for sensitive skin.
- Aloe Vera Extract: Known for its healing and soothing properties, promoting skin regeneration.
- Calendula Extract: Possesses anti-inflammatory and antiseptic properties, effective in treating minor skin irritations.

Reading Ingredient Labels Critically
Understanding ingredient labels is paramount. Look for recognizable botanical oils, butters, and extracts. Be wary of products with long lists of unpronounceable chemicals, as these often indicate the presence of synthetic ingredients. Check for certifications such as organic or fair trade, indicating sustainable and ethical sourcing practices. Pay attention to the order of ingredients—those listed first are present in the highest concentration.
